ResourceBundle::getLocales

(PHP >= 5.3.2, PECL intl >= 2.0.0)
Get supported locales
public array ResourceBundle::getLocales ( string $bundlename )

Object oriented style

Procedural style

array resourcebundle_locales ( string $bundlename )

Get available locales from ResourceBundle name.

Parameters:
bundlename

Path of ResourceBundle for which to get available locales, or empty string for default locales list.

Returns:

Returns the list of locales supported by the bundle.

Examples:
resourcebundle_locales() example
<?php
$bundle = "/user/share/data/myapp";
echo join(PHP_EOL, resourcebundle_locales($bundle));
?>

The above example will output something similar to:

es
root
OO example
<?php
$bundle = "/usr/share/data/myapp";
$r = new ResourceBundle( 'es', $bundle);
echo join("\n", $r->getLocales($bundle));
?>

The above example will output something similar to:

es
root
See also:

resourcebundle_get() -

doc_php
2016-02-24 15:57:52
Comments
Leave a Comment

Please login to continue.